Автор: Пользователь скрыл имя, 22 Октября 2014 в 20:25, курсовая работа
Анализируя сущность АРМ, специалисты определяют их чаще всего как профессионально-ориентированные малые вычислительные системы, расположенные непосредственно на рабочих местах специалистов и предназначенные для автоматизации их работ.
Hа производственных предприятиях АРМ являются важной структурной составляющей АСУ как персональное средство планирования, управления, обработки данных.
Введение 2
Глава 1 Проектирование информационной системы
отдела кадров ДГУП «Рыбницкая почта» ¬¬ 4
1.1 Обоснование предметной области 4
1.2 Разработка функциональной модели средствами Bpwin 6
1.3 Разработка информационной модели средствами Erwin 16
1.4 Разработка объектно-ориентированной модели средствами
Rational Rose
Глава 2 Разработка автоматизированного рабочего места
инспектора отдела кадров ДГУП «Рыбницкая почта» 24
2.1. Назначение, основные задачи разработки АРМ 24
2.2. Выбор средств для реализации программного продукта 29
2.3. Описание программного продукта 30
2.4. Тестирование и отладка программы 40
Глава 3 Анализ организации управления персоналом
ДГУП «Рыбницкая почта» 42
3.1. Органицазационно - экономическая сущность задач 42
управления персоналом
3.2. Кадровый потенциал предприятия 40
3.2.1. Количественная характеристика трудовых ресурсов 42
3.2.2. Качественная характеристика трудовых ресурсов 44
(персонала)
3.3. Управление кадрами (персоналом) 47
Заключение 52
Список литературы
- базы данных, содержащая несколько тысяч записей, может поместиться на одной дискете;
- возможность просмотра отчетов за предыдущие периоды.
С помощью средств СУБД можно:
- на основе запроса можно выбрать информацию, предоставляющую для пользователя интерес;
- напечатать всю таблицу или только выбранные записи и поля в различных форматах;
- выполнить различные
Visual FoxPro позволяет сэкономить ваше время и деньги на каждом этапе процесса создания приложения. При работе возможно сохранение каждого прототипа в качестве класса и использование его при создании новых форм. На следующих стадиях разработки приложения (и даже после того, как работа над приложением уже завершена) можно в любой момент вернуться к нужному объекту и изменить или расширить его свойства, не нарушая целостности других объектов.
В связи с этим данная программная среда была использована для решения задач управления персоналом; в частности, для автоматизации рабочего места инспектора отдела кадров.
2.2. Описание программного продукта
База данных выполняет две наиболее важные функции. Во-первых, она предоставляет данные из базы данных в удобном для пользователя виде, а во-вторых, производит различные манипуляции с хранящейся информацией (расчет, поиск, печать и т.д.).
База данных была создана в интерактивном режиме с помощью конструктора базы данных, она позволяет
- создавать и модифицировать таблицы, представления данных;
- добавлять созданные ранее таблицы;
-устанавливать отношения между таблицами, которые поддерживаются при создании форм и отчетов.
Все данные описанного программного продукта хранятся в базе данных, которая состоит из таблиц и отношений между ними.
Данная база данных (рис.15.) состоит
из следующих таблиц: people, obrazovanie, perepodgotovka,
kfalifikazia, attestazia, lgotu, nagradu, otdel, rasspisanie, type-sem,
voin-ychet, otpyck, yvolnenie и др.
Рис.15. « Структура база данных»
Таблицы составляют основу базы данных. В них хранится вся необходимая информация. В дальнейшем данные в таблице будут дополняться новыми сведениями, редактироваться или исключаться из нее. Каждая таблица имеет уникальное имя.
Чрезвычайно удобным и полезным средством доступа к базе данных являются представления данных. Представления данных позволяют объединять данные таблиц и отображать их более удобном виде. Возможно, выбрать только интересующие поля таблиц, объединить несколько полей в одно поле, вычислить итоговые значения. По мере эксплуатации базы данных их число непрерывно растет.
Между таблицами существует отношение один-ко-многим. Например, отношение между человеком и его образованием (рис.16.) и т.д.
Рис.16. «Отношение между таблицами»
Из двух связанных таблиц одна является главной, а другая – подчиненной. Главную таблицу называют родительской, а подчиненную – дочерней. Важным требованием, которое предъявляется к базе данных является целостность данных. Для определения условий целостности данных в базе данных проекта необходимо выявить установленные отношения между таблицами.
Структура меню.
После того как определена
структура данных, спроектированы
таблицы, входящие в базу данных,
была разработана структура
Работа с программой начинается с запуска приложения, в котором с помощью меню легко “передвигаться” из одного документа в другой.
ёёё
Рис 17. « Структура меню»
При выборе пункта меню «Сотрудники» открывается форма, в которой перечислен весь кадровый состав. На этой форме осуществляется поиск нужного сотрудника. Для выбранного сотрудника открывается форма «Личная карточка», которая содержит следующие сведения:
- Образование;
- Семья;
- Воинский учет;
- Повышения квалификации;
- Профессиональная
- Аттестация;
- Награды и поощрения;
Вкладка «Образование», позволяет просмотреть информацию, какое имеется у данного сотрудника образование. Вкладка «Семья» – о составе семьи, а «Аттестация» – результаты проведенной аттестации и др.
На личной карточке также имеются приказы: прием и перевод, отпуск, увольнение. Чтобы узнать, в какое структурное подразделение, на какую должность назначен сотрудник, открываем форму «Прием и перевод». На форме «Отпуск» дается информация о предоставляемом отпуске. «Увольнение» содержит дату и причину ухода с работы.
Второй пункт меню, «Штатное расписание», где указывается отдел, должность, количество единиц и оклад. Отдел можно выбрать из предложенного списка, если такого нет, то открывается связанная форма, где можно добавить и удалить отдел.
При выборе пункта «Статистика» необходимо ввести начало и конец периода для формирования отчета. Данные станут параметрами для запроса, благодаря которому осуществляется выборка нужной информации из базы данных.
Пункт меню «Отчеты» имеет подменю: график отпусков; центр занятости.
«График отпусков» позволяет просмотреть информацию о запланированном и фактическом отпуске сотрудников разных отделов.
Отчет, предоставляемый в «Центр занятости », содержит сведения о наличии на предприятии вакантных мест на текущий момент времени.
В пункте меню «Договор» также перечислены все сотрудники предприятия. При выборе нужной позиции из списка можно просмотреть заключенный с данным сотрудником договор.
В «Табеле рабочего времени» для всех сотрудников выбранного отдела из имеющегося списка можно увидеть количество отработанного времени по дням за определенный период времени, который также можно выбрать на этой форме.
Для завершения работы с приложением предусмотрен пункт меню «Выход».
Данные заносятся в базу данных через специально разработанные формы.
Ведение данных по сотруднику осуществляется в форме личной карточки, которая содержит сведения о сотруднике: фамилия, имя, отчество, биографические данные, табельный номер сотрудника, сведения о выполняемой в настоящее время работе, паспортные данные, семейное положение и т.п.
Личная карточка сотрудника представляет собой специальный бланк, содержащий необходимые сведения о работнике данной организации. Прежде всего, это индивидуальные данные работника, его гражданство, степень знания языков, образование.
Личная карточка также включает в себя дополнительную информацию, а именно: наименование организации образования, квалификация по документу образования, направление или специальность по диплому. В личной карточке указаны всяческие передвижения по службе, сведения о благодарностях, выговорах, о награждениях. Данные о повышении квалификационного уровня работника также находят отражения в его личной карточке. После прохождения аттестации учреждения в личной карточке работника указывается соответствие занимаемой должности.
Пользователь имеет возможность вводить новые данные в личную карточку.
В открывающейся форме «Личная карточка» (рис.17.) существует стандартный набор кнопок, таких как «Первая», «Следующая», «Предыдущая», «Последняя», «Добавить», «Удалить», «Изменить», «Выход». Выход из любого режима осуществляется при нажатии указателем мыши на кнопке «Выход ».
Рис.17. Форма «Личная карточка»
На форме личной карточки имеются приказы: прием (рис.18), отпуск (рис.19), увольнение.
Рис.18. Форма «Прием и перевод»
Прием на работу оформляется приказом (распоряжением) руководителя, изданным на основании заключенного трудового договора. Работник может быть переведен из одного структурного подразделения предприятия в другое. Для этого просматривается штатное расписание и если имеются вакансии, то оформляется приказ о переводе
Работникам предоставляются ежегодные отпуска с сохранением места работы и среднего заработка.
Оплачиваемый отпуск должен предоставляться работнику ежегодно.
При увольнении работнику выплачивается денежная компенсация за все неиспользованные отпуска.
Форма «отпуск» позволяет просмотреть имеющиеся у данного сотрудника отпуска, а также вводить очередной отпуск.
Форма «штатное расписание» предназначена для разработки штатного расписания предприятия с возможностью распределения планируемых работ между штатными должностными единицами. Она применяется для планирования загруженности штатных должностей предприятия на основании описанных работ и формирования приказов о перераспределении работ. Также она позволяет оперативно изменять загрузку персонала, обоснованно формировать требования, инструкции и условия работы для набора, расстановки и увольнения персонала по штатным должностям.
Должностной и численный состав предприятия с указанием фонда заработной платы закрепляется в штатном расписании (рис.20.). В нем ведется
список штатных единиц, диапазон оплаты труда и должностные инструкции по каждой штатной единице. Спланированное штатное расписание может загружаться в текущее штатное расписание кадровой подсистемы.
Рис.20. Форма «Штатное расписание»
Необходимым документом, на основании которого начисляется заработная
Рис.21. Форма «Табель рабочего времени»
плата работникам, является табель учета рабочего времени. Он представляет собой соответствующий бланк, где указаны фамилии работников и степень их загруженности в процессе работы.
В табеле также даны сведения о наличии больничных листов, дополнительных замен, отпусков. Табель подписывается руководителем данного отдела и передается в бухгалтерию.
В программе возможно формирование отчетов и вывод их на печать. Отчетом можно считать выведенную на печать отобранную личную карточку сотрудника. приказы, штатное расписание и табель рабочего времени (см.приложение 1):
- приказ о приеме работника на работу;
- приказ о прекращении трудового договора с работником;
- приказ
о переводе работника на
- приказ
о предоставлении отпуска
- личная карточка, трудовой договор;
- график ежегодных отпусков, содержащиеся в графическом виде сведения об использованном и планируемом отпуске.
Перепроектирование базы данных привело ее к дополнению ее таблицами: perepodgotovka, kfalifikazia, attestazia, lgotu, nagradu. База данных построена таким образом, чтобы пользователь мог по необходимости заполнить таблицы нужной информацией.
Если личная карточка до разработки програмнного продукта содержала такие сведения, такие как: общие сведения, воинский учет, семья, прием и перемещение, отпуска, то с появлением новых стандартов документов дополнилась такими данными, как аттестация, профессиональная переподготовка, повышение квалификации, льготы, награды. Таблицы были заполнены частично вследствие отсутствия на предприятии выше перечисленной информации.
База данных была заполнена
информацией с первичных
Если до тестирования программного продукта в деятельность отдела кадров специалист затрачивал массу времени на поиск необходимой информации (из архива, текущей документации), то при помощи автоматизированного рабочего места эта операция проходит за считанные секунды.
Для написания программного продукта был выбран VisualFoxPro 5.0., который позволяет выбрать информацию, предоставляющую для пользователя интерес; напечатать всю таблицу или только выбранные записи и поля в различных форматах; выполнить различные вычисления в процессе подготовки отчетов или выборку данных из таблиц. Также было разработано приложение, в котором с помощью меню легко “передвигаться” из одного документа в другой. Меню состоит из следующих пунктов: Сотрудники, Штатное расписание, Договор, Табель, Статистика, Отчеты, Выход.
Информация о работе Анализ организации управления персоналом ДГУП «Рыбницкая почта»